The venue is situated outside the centre of the town.
This venue is situated in Littlehampton.
The venue is not on a road with a steep gradient.
The nearest mainline Railway Station is Littlehampton.
There is a bus stop within 150m (164yds) of the venue.
This venue does have its own car park.
Parking is free for all users.
The car park is at the front of the venue.
The car park type is open air/surface.
There are 2 designated parking bay(s) within the car park.
The dimensions of the designated parking bay(s) are 2.4m x 4.5m (7ft 10in x 14ft 9in).
The nearest designated bay is 7m (22ft 11in) from the main entrance.
The furthest designated bay is 20m (22yd) from the main entrance.
The route from the car park to the entrance is accessible to a wheelchair user unaided.
The car park surface is tarmac.
The patron does not have to cross a road.
The car park does not have a height restriction barrier.
There is not a designated drop off point.
This information is for the entrance located to the front of the building.
There is level access to the service.
The main doors open automatically.
The doors are double width.
The door opening is 180cm (5ft 10in) wide.
There is level access to the service.
The lighting levels are medium.
Motorised scooters are allowed in public parts of the venue.
Customers can charge scooters or wheelchairs at the venue.
The following information is for the cafe.
Once inside, there is level access to the service.
Food or drinks are ordered from the service counter.
Food or drinks can be brought to the table.
There is not a lowered section at the service counter.
There is ample room for a wheelchair user to manoeuvre.
No tables are permanently fixed.
No chairs are permanently fixed.
All chairs have armrests.
The nearest table is 12m (13yd) from the main entrance.
The distance between the floor and the lowest dining table is 70cm (2ft 3in) cm.
The distance between the floor and the highest dining table is 70cm (2ft 3in) cm.
Menus are hand held.
Menus are not available in Braille.
Menus are available in large print.
Menus are clearly written.
Menus are presented in contrasting colours.
The type of food served here is varied hot and cold meals.
There are adapted toilets within this venue designated for public use.
The toilet is not for the sole use of disabled people.
There is no additional signage on or near the toilet door.
The adapted toilet is 18m (20yd) from the main entrance.
The adapted toilet is located to the right as you enter.
There is level access to the adapted toilet.
This is a unisex toilet.
A key is not required for the adapted toilet.
The door opens outwards.
The door is locked by a sliding bolt.
The width of the adapted toilet door is 93cm (3ft ).
The door is heavy.
The dimensions of the adapted toilet are 170cm x 254cm (5ft 6in x 8ft 4in).
Floor manoeuvring space is clear in the adapted toilet.
There is a lateral transfer space.
As you face the toilet pan the transfer space is on the right.
The lateral transfer space is 100cm (3ft 3in).
There is a dropdown rail on the transfer side.
There is a flush on the transfer side.
The tap type is lever.
There is a mixer tap.
There is not a functional emergency alarm available.
No emergency alarm is fitted in the cubicle.
Disposal facilities are available in the cubicle.
There is not a coat hook.
Wall mounted rails are available.
As you face the toilet the wall mounted grab rails are on both sides.
There is not a shelf within the adapted toilet.
There are mirrors in the adapted toilet.
Mirrors are not placed at a lower level or at an angle for ease of use.
The height of the toilet seat above floor level is 47cm (1ft 6in).
There is a hand dryer.
The hand dryer cannot be reached from seated on the toilet.
The hand dryer is placed higher than 100cm.
The hand dryer is 123cm (4ft ) high.
There is a towel dispenser.
The towel dispenser cannot be reached from seated on the toilet.
The towel dispenser is placed higher than 100cm.
The towel dispenser is 140cm (4ft 7in) high.
There is a toilet roll holder.
The toilet roll holder can be reached from seated on the toilet.
The toilet roll holder is not placed higher than 100cm.
There is a sink.
The sink cannot be reached from seated on the toilet.
The sink is placed higher than 74cm.
The sink is 75cm (2ft 5in) high.
The contrast between the internal door and wall is good.
The contrast between the external door and wall is good.
The contrast between the grab rails and wall is good.
The contrast between the drop down rails and wall is good.
The contrast between the walls and floor is good.
Lighting levels are medium.
Baby change facilities are not located within the venue.
The adapted toilet also serves as a unisex standard toilet.
